The shooting star display is caused by comet dust entering the earth’s atmosphere most of it burns up, but sometimes it hits the ground at breath taking speeds. There’s been about 21 recorded deaths
in around the last 100 years from meteorite strikes.
Some of this icy material enters Earth’s upper atmosphere at a speed of 133,000 miles per hour but burns up almost instantly and at a safe distance from the planet’s surface.
